The Importance of Weight and Volume Measurement in Aviation
- Safety: Accurate measurements of weight and volume are essential for the safety of aviation operations. Overloading aircraft can lead to increased risks during flight, such as reduced fuel efficiency and difficulties during take-off and landing.
- Efficiency: By accurately measuring the weight and volume of both passenger and freight loads, airlines can make optimal use of their cargo capacity. This ensures more efficient operations and maximizes profitability.
- Cost control: Airlines are constantly looking for ways to reduce costs. Accurate measurements help optimize cargo, reducing unnecessary fuel costs and other operational expenses.
- Regulation and Compliance: The aviation industry is highly regulated, and meeting aviation authority requirements for weight and volume is critical. Incorrect measurements can lead to penalties and operational delays.
Technologies for Weight and Volume Measurement
There are several advanced technologies and methods available for weight and volume measurement in aviation:
1. Digital Scales
Digital scales are essential for accurately measuring the weight of baggage and cargo. These scales are often integrated into check-in and loading stations, allowing for fast and efficient handling.
2. Volumetric Measurements
Various technologies are available for measuring the volume of freight:
- Laser and Ultrasonic Measurements: These technologies use laser or ultrasonic waves to calculate the volume of packages, which is particularly useful for irregularly shaped loads.
- 3D Scanners: 3D scanners create a detailed model of the load, which allows for accurate volume calculations and improved efficiency in the loading process.
3. Combined Weighing and Volume Systems
Some modern systems combine weight and volume measurement in one process. This reduces the time required for handling freight and increases the accuracy of the data.
Benefits of Weight and Volume Measurement in Aviation
- Time saving: Advanced measurement methods enable faster baggage and cargo handling, resulting in shorter waiting times at airports and improved customer satisfaction.
- Improved Data Analysis: Accurate weight and volume data enables airlines to analyze trends and make better decisions about their operations and strategies.
- Load Capacity Optimization: By accurately measuring the weight and volume of cargo, airlines can make optimal use of available cargo capacity, resulting in increased revenues and improved operational efficiency.
- Increased Reliability: The use of modern technologies for weight and volume measurement reduces the risk of human error and increases the overall reliability of operations.
